Precision medicine is an emerging approach for prevention and treatement of disease, taking into account individual differences in people’s genes, environment and life style. The development of precision medicine relies on a combination of knowledge of human “omics” and new technology for molecular diagnostics as well as methods for handling big data. AIMday Precision Medicine is a meeting focused on bringing academic scientists, clinicians and company representatives together for discussions on this subject.
